Bu, Ubuntu Online, Fedora Online, Windows çevrimiçi emülatörü veya MAC OS çevrimiçi emülatörü gibi birden fazla ücretsiz çevrimiçi iş istasyonumuzdan birini kullanarak OnWorks ücretsiz barındırma sağlayıcısında çalıştırılabilen jsonlint komutudur.
Program:
ADI
jsonlint - Bir JSON sözdizimi doğrulayıcı ve biçimlendirici aracı
SİNOPSİS
jsonlint [-v][-s|-S][-f|-F][-ekodek]girdi dosyası.json...
TANIM
Bu kılavuz sayfası kısaca şunları belgelemektedir: jsonlint emreder.
SEÇENEKLER
Dosya yasal JSON ise iade durumu 0 olur, aksi takdirde sıfırdan farklı olur. -v için kullanın
uyarı ayrıntılarına bakın.
Seçenekler: -içinde, -Evet, S, -F, -F, -e
-içinde, --ayrıntılı
Tüy kontrolü ayrıntılarını göster
-Evet, --sıkı
Yasal JSON olarak kabul edilenler konusunda katı olun (varsayılan)
S, --kesin olmayan
Yasal JSON olarak kabul edilen şeyde gevşek olun
-F, --biçim
JSON'u (yasalsa) stdout olarak yeniden biçimlendirin
-F, --format-kompakt olarak
JSON simlar'ı -f olarak yeniden biçimlendirin, ancak gereksiz tüm öğeleri kaldırarak bunu kompakt bir şekilde yapın.
boşluk
-e kodek, --encoding=kodek
--input-kodlama=kodek --output-kodlayıcı=kodek
Giriş ve çıkış karakter kodlama codec'ini ayarlayın (örneğin, ascii, utf8, utf-16). NS
-e, hem giriş hem de çıkış kodlamalarını aynı şeye ayarlayacaktır. değilse
sağlandığında, giriş kodlaması JSON belirtimine göre tahmin edilir. NS
çıktı kodlaması varsayılan olarak UTF-8'dir ve yeniden biçimlendirilirken kullanılır (-f veya -F aracılığıyla
seçenekler).
Yeniden biçimlendirme sırasında, nesnelerin tüm üyeleri (ilişkisel diziler) her zaman çıktı olarak alınır.
sözlüksel sıralama. -e seçeneği olmadığı sürece varsayılan çıktı codec bileşeni UTF-8'dir.
sağlanır. Herhangi bir Unicode karakteri, aşağıdaki durumlarda değişmez karakterler olarak çıkarılacaktır:
kodlama izinleri, aksi takdirde -kaçarlar. Zorlamak için "-e ascii" kullanabilirsiniz.
tüm Unicode karakterleri kaçacak.
onworks.net hizmetlerini kullanarak jsonlint'i çevrimiçi kullanın